Whiteout causes multiple crashes on I‑475, Lucas County OH

As discussed during the dispatch call, multiple vehicles were involved in apparent weather‑related crashes along northbound I‑475 in Ohio amid near‑whiteout conditions. Officials requested assistance from the state transportation safety patrol to manage traffic and prevent additional pileups. The incident appears to involve several vehicles between Central Avenue and Route 23, with hazardous road and visibility conditions contributing to the situation.
